You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
This repository contains the user documentation for JSDoc. Use this repository to report
documentation bugs, and to submit pull requests for improving the docs.
If you just want to read the documentation, please visit Use JSDoc.
Contributing to the documentation
The HTML docs are generated with Eleventy. If you'd like to contribute to the docs, make
sure Node.js and npm are installed, then follow these steps:
Make your changes in the content directory, which contains the source files for the docs.
The first few lines of each source file contain YAML front matter, which is metadata in
YAML format. If you need to use the character @ or [ at the start of a YAML value, you
can escape it with a backslash. For example, write title: @class as title: \@class.
Rebuild the HTML files, and run a local server so that you can review them:
npm run serve
Review the updated HTML files on the local server, and make sure your changes look okay. In
particular, if you edited the YAML front matter, make sure your changes are reflected in the
generated HTML files.
Send a pull request with your changes.
Legal stuff
Copyright 2011 by the contributors to the JSDoc documentation.